Denmark - Number of Road Injury Accidents on Motorways
Since 2014, Denmark Number of Road Injury Accidents on Motorways was up 8.9% year on year. In 2019, the country was number 24 comparing other countries in Number of Road Injury Accidents on Motorways at 173 Accidents. Denmark is overtaken by Azerbaijan, which was number 23 with 182 Accidents and is followed by Finland with 163 Accidents. Germany topped the ranking with 20,870 Accidents in 2019, that is an increase of 1.6% compared to 2018. Spain, Italy and France resp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Romania witnessed the best average annual growth at +12.1% per year, while Macedonia recorded the worst performance at -2.1% per year.
